What Is Hashing? [Step-by-Step Guide-Under Hood Of Blockchain]
What kind of transactions are bitcoin used for what encryption bitcoin uses sha Suppose you are dealing bitcoin futures launch by cme group ethereum fork countdown a bit hash. New nodes find a seed node 1 node in the network from a list of seed nodes. Puzzle is used for Bitcoin mining. Bitcoin scripting language: However, merchant can be sure of the correct transaction by tracking the number of confirmations of acceptance.
These puzzles discourage all mining pools including harmless decentralized mining pools. Under certain conditions, the protocol can be stuck. Application specific integrated circuit. Receiving virtual currency. A random node gets to broadcast its block. You are going to send email to. Select a random node: If you meet any random stranger out on the streets the chances are very low for both of you to have the same birthday. Intro to Crypto. Higher performance than GPUs.
Send transactions to Namecoin network in order to maintain your domain. Each block contains thousands and thousands of transactions. This data is not validated in the Bitcoin network.
Now you have the right to redeem a Basecoin that you had spent earlier to create the Zerocoin. But Tor is optimized for low latency web browsing so it compromises anonymity. Retrieved 24 February If Miekeljohn et Al. Stop large amounts of money from 1 crossing borders or 2 moving between underground to legitimate economy without detection.
Two types of market failures are discussed 1 Lemons market and 2 Price fixing. As you may have guessed by now, this is what the structure of the blockchain is based on. All nodes are equal. Is Cunnigham chain useful? Miners can verify proofs.
Collision attack Preimage attack Birthday attack Brute-force attack Rainbow table Side-channel attack Length extension attack. This avoids double spending. Recent Posts Nope, because attacker cannot forge a signature due to cryptography. For example, adding a period to the end of this sentence changes almost half out of of the bits in the hash:. How to build online lotteries without trust? If the hash rate is too fast the difficulty level is increased.
How to prevent Sybil attack? So a 48 bit message with the added one will need to have zeros added to the end, and if the message was 64 characters or bits long you would need zeros. Total hashpower. Bitcoin Transactions — Scriptsig and Scriptpubkey — locking and unlocking a transaction? In case of hard fork, they control which fork to extend. Bitcoin uses SHA as crypto hash fn.
Fiat currency e. They then publish x, y and z. Mining Pools Economics of being a smaller miner: Interative protocols for anonymity are hard to decentralize e.
This cryptocurrency is a hard fork of Bitcoin that was created to decrease fees associated with Bitcoin transactions by increasing block size. Reputable but regulated. How P2P nodes should behave. Proof of stake: The issuer of the metadata has to be trusted. The hash function should be capable of returning the hash of an input quickly.
The shares still need to be combined in order to reconstruct the secret. New blocks are announced using the same algo as new transactions.
Spender makes 2 transactions and publishes. Variations in virtual mining: Bitcoin-like altcoin. So a 48 bit message with the added one will need to have zeros added to the end, and if the message new bitmain 14nm miner nheqminer cpu mining 64 characters or bits long you would need zeros. Do miners have the power? Aspects of decentralization in Bitcoin: Half of the profits made within the first 6 mths. It is just pure brute-force where the software keep on randomly generating strings till they reach their goal.
Pseudo-collision attack against up to 46 rounds of SHA It absorbs all of the risks involved in the process. Bottom up approach: How does the Bitcoin Network actually work? Hash rate basically means how fast these hashing operations are taking place while mining.
Do Bitcoin core devs have the power? Principles of mixes: List of bitcoin companies List of bitcoin organizations Building the best zcash rig replacement for circle bitcoin of people in blockchain technology. Pseudocode for the SHA algorithm follows. Finding a valid block: Take value of block header and run it through an extractor function. What Is Hashing? New nodes can be added at any time. Change addresses can also be detected with heuristics change addresses are addresses where the change is sent ater you buy a product that is lesser than the input.
Can attacker suppress some transactions? Now you have rollin bitcoin hack sell fee coinbase bank account right to redeem a Basecoin that you had spent earlier to create the Zerocoin. This is because to create a longer chain, you now need to add a lot more blocks and adding blocks requires PoW.
They are everywhere on the internet, mostly used to secure passwords, but they also make up an integral part of most cryptocurrencies such as Bitcoin and Litecoin. As of December [update]there gtx hashrate ethereum bitcoin bank cycler over validated implementations of SHA and over of SHA, with only 5 of them being capable of handling messages with a length in bits not a multiple of eight while supporting both variants.
Require businesses to identify and authenticate who their clients are and tie their activities to people in the real world. Colour is the metadata and you can add this to a Bitcoin. Some miners may not abide by these rules but most follow them so your transaction will eventually make it into the blockchain.
Instead of merging inputs for payments, why not have a protocol so that the receiver can provide multiple output addresses? Nobody knows who this person s is. Only the leafs store the values. They only promise that they will give you the coins you own. Mozilla disabled SHA-1 in early January , but had to re-enable it temporarily via a Firefox update, after problems with web-based user interfaces of some router models and security appliances.
Problem is double spending spending the same coin twice because blockchain is not published by Goofy. Timing is imprecise, manipulation cost may be too low if we have millions of dollars on the line. Just use SHA2 since its well understood. If at least 1 routing node is honest, then the communication is safe-ish Safe-ish because it might still be possible to determine that A and B are communicating if the attacker controls incoming and outgoing requests into and out of the network by using timestamps of the network activity.
Very convenient. If fork was meant as altcoin, then both branches coexist peacefully. Problem is that its centralized Scrooge i. Now cold wallet can go offline and hot wallet can generate new addresses for each coin by calling the address generator with a new integer input. Incentive 1: Anti-counterfeiting properties are inherited from the currency.
Coins issued by passing through pay to hash address that will add the colour. Navigation menu Cryptomining malware: Mine by sending money to a special address. Popular Exchanges Binance. No hash function is collision free, but it usually takes so long to find a collision. Can we combine all micro payments to make 1 large payment? Why maintain this property? Proof of Useful Work Bitcoin network consumes same power as a small power plant.
Attacker may choose to discard all mined blocks or pay others to discard a block. Decentralized arbitration. The greatest strength of decentralization is its resilience: List Comparison Known attacks. Average time to find a block is about 10 mins. Another hash function that uses k is used to get h2. Decentralized applications: Scherschel, HeiseSecurity: Bitcoin is a decentralized cryptocurrency that relies on the blockchain to distribute its ledger and record proof of work.
Efficient micro payments: If the blocks were allowed to be created faster, it would result in:.
SHA-256 Cryptographic Hash Algorithm
Questions tagged [encryption]. Ask Question. Learn more… Top users Synonyms. Filter by. Sorted by. Tagged. Apply filter. Bitcoin and encryption To the best of my understanding Bitcoin uses encryption to create the digital signature, basically, by encrypting the hashed message transaction?
Would like to source your expert opinion to my claim Moti 3 3 bronze badges. Bitcoin Private Key Decryption At present, I have dumped my wallet and have all private key, address information.
I am now wanting to understand the decryption process for the private keys within the wallet. I have completed the Ironically, encryption is not an important part of bitcoin?
The above statement is taken out of a book which I've been reading: Mastering Bitcoin 2nd Edition. Why doesn't the Bitcoin-qt client ask for the Wallet passphrase upon startup? I've just encrypted my wallet. I then closed the client and re-opened it. I what encryption bitcoin uses sha 265 expecting to be prompted to put in the wallet password Felipe 5 5 bronze badges.
Can't decrypt bitcoin core wallet, did I made a backup at the wrong time? I am confused on why my bitcoin core wallet password would not work. How is the "Private Key" created in the first place? I understand that once you have your wallet, you will also gain access to your public key and private key But in order to have a wallet What happens when i change the encryption password of Bitcoin-Core wallet What happens when i change the encryption password of Bitcoin-Core wallet?
Is first pass lost foreverwhere is it saved - on the blockchain or on the wallet. What if encrypt wallet with Has Bitcoin Cores encryption wallet security ever been bypassable? Every few years there seems to be an exploit found in Trezor that allows people to bypass the security. I was wondering has there every been the same case for Bitcoin Core wallet encryption? Toodarday 5 5 bronze badges. Why was noise XK fundamental pattern chosen in the transport layer BOLT 08 of the lightning network I am currently reviewing the transport layer of the Lightning network protocol.
It builds on top of the noise protocol framework handshake patterns. What I don't get: Why was the fundamental pattern Rene Pickhardt 6, 2 2 silver badges 20 20 bronze badges. Bitcoin Signatures are susceptible to quantum attacks - how exactly and with what practical impact?
How may bitcoins hash algorithm be secured in the future from quantum computing brute forcing? Now: Are there any ideas among the bitcoin devs circulating out there, how to save bitcoin Does a Standardized Shamir Sharing protocol exist?
Upstream 21 4 4 bronze badges. Is it possible to run HD derivation with an encrypted master node or seed? Given either a seed or the private part of a master node, that is encrypted using AESCBC or another secured symmetrical cypher with key K, is it possible to run derivation such as described in Kyll 3 3 bronze badges. Chris Franko Jennings 41 1 1 bronze badge. Is the unencrypted copy of the wallet still usable after a copy is encrypted?
My wallet is not protected with a password, I have a few receiving addresses generated and a some funds in it, then I make a copy of the wallet and I set a password on this one. Will the old Doe 11 1 1 bronze badge. Is blockchain really secure to store sensitive data? Plenty of developers these days trying to decentralise. I noticed some developers claim that they are gonna replace email with blockchain technology. Giri 3 3 bronze badges.
Why bitcoind will shutdown after encryptwallet? As mentioned in the bitcoin-cli document for encryptwallet command, bitcoin daemon will shut down after encrypting a new or unencrypted wallet.
My question is about the reason for shutting the node Is encryption really needed for blockchain to work? Is it right to say what encryption bitcoin uses sha 265 Bitcoin and other blockchains do not use encryption? I read somewhere that blockchains rely on digital signatures and hash functions but not on encryption, and that encryption Slmk 3 1 1 bronze badge. Or data confidentiality is not part of blockchain feature?
Samantha 55 5 5 bronze badges. I have the following text string: This is a test message. Using my bitcoin public key bitcoin address? How would I decrypt the message using a bitcoin private key?
I'm looking to create a How does blockchain technology handle the actual transaction data? My understanding of how a transaction is secured in blockchain, especially in bitcoin, is that the output of transaction data is locked to the recipient's address a shorter version of his public key Nicholas 3 3 bronze badges. How can I use messengers for crypto transactions? Is it possible to use Signal or Telegram for crypto transactions?
I heard CryptoCat messenger is for such needs, but interested in using those two mentioned. SoyerGun 21 1 1 bronze badge. It's pretty clear how signing a message with a Bitcoin key can be useful in proving ownership of funds. However, it's far from clear how encrypting a message with a Bitcoin key can do anything useful Rich Apodaca 1, 11 11 silver badges 31 31 bronze badges. Is the Mycelium HD wallet private key stored encrypted on the device? My concern is that I'm using a corporate bring you own device phone.
We have to install a "security" app running with administrator rights. IMHO this app Romeo Kienzler 4 4 bronze badges. Could BitCoin network be destroyed if blockchain would get corrupted? This thought came to me whilst watching mr. Robot where the entire database of a financial corporation has been encrypted.
Would that in theory be possible if a virus was spread that would target Ivan Venediktov 1 1 bronze badge. Solving a Block with more than one miner connected to same daemon Well excuse me in advance if my question sounds funny. But I'm just curious perhaps someone can shed a light. When in a pool of miners, let's say there are miners connected to a single daemon GoodtheBest 3 3 3 bronze badges.
How are transactions verified by nodes other than the initial receiver? If I understand correctly, what encryption bitcoin uses sha 265 I create a new transaction from my wallet, I have to sign it and encrypt it.
My wallet encrypts the message using the public key of the node it is connected to, so it How does Electrum protect my Seed?
New nodes can be added at any time. No hash function is collision free, but it usually http://trackmyurl.biz/what-is-the-best-site-to-buy-bitcoins-7765.html so long to find a collision. There are practical circumstances in which this is possible; until the end ofit was possible to create forged SSL certificates using an MD5 collision which would be accepted by widely used web browsers. The block header would then be hashed, however, if the resulting hash proves to be above the target, the miner must try. This bitckin double spending. These functions should be simple to translate into other languages if required, though can also be used as-is in browsers and Node. They only promise that they will give you the coins you. National 625 Agency. Bitcoin Cash:. Money portal. Namespaces Article Talk. List Comparison Known attacks. If at least 1 routing node is honest, then the communication is safe-ish Safe-ish because it might still be possible to determine that A and B are communicating if the attacker controls what encryption bitcoin uses sha 265 and outgoing requests into and out of the network by using timestamps of the network activity. Just use SHA2 since its well understood. Cryptology ePrint Archive Technical report. Popular Exchanges Binance.